“No obstacles left for new START treaty”

A new START treaty will most likely be signed at the end of the week, as the sides do not have any major disagreements, said Evgeny Myasnikov from the Center for Arms Control.

“What negotiators are currently doing is that they are trying to fix all the disagreements, but I don’t think there are fundamental disagreements at this point,” Myasnikov said.

”I think the scope of the treaty is quite clear and they are trying to fix the details of the verification system.”
